This Neurochemical Landscape of Tryptamine Receptors

Tryptamine receptors represent a fascinating group of G-protein coupled receptors (GPCRs) widely distributed throughout the central and peripheral nervous regions. These receptors are associated in a broad range of physiological processes, including sleep-wake cycles, as well as having a role in the pathophysiology of various neurological and psychiatric illnesses. The intricate mechanisms activated by tryptamine receptor activators are increasingly being explored, providing crucial insights into the complex neurochemical landscape of these receptors.

Serotonin's Cousins: Exploring the Diverse Effects of Tryptamines

Tryptamines, a extensive family of compounds, have captivated the scientific community for their intriguing effects on the human brain and body. Sharing a common structural element with serotonin, these molecules attach to similar receptors, producing a range of physiological and psychological outcomes. From the well-known mood-altering properties of LSD to the neuroprotective potential of certain tryptamines, this intriguing class of compounds offers a glimpse into the complex interplay between chemistry and consciousness.
